Bernas expands Smart SBB in Kota Belud

PADIBERAS Nasional Bhd (Bernas) has expanded its Large-Scale Smart Paddy Field (Smart SBB) Ala Sekinchan programme to Kg Kesapang Tengah, Kota Belud, covering 175 hectares.

This initiative aims to enhance Malaysia’s food security by optimizing land use and adopting best agricultural practices. Agriculture and Food Security Minister Datuk Seri Mohamad Sabu highlighted the program’s success in increasing paddy yields and boosting local rice production.

Bernas has provided farmers with nine state-of-the-art machines and advanced agricultural equipment worth RM1 million. The program, benefiting 81 farmers in Kota Belud and over 735 farmers nationwide, has significantly increased crop yields and farmers’ incomes.

“The remarkable success of the Smart SBB Ala Sekinchan Bernas programme is pivotal in achieving Sabah’s local rice production goals, signifying the commitment of the Ministry.

“It ensures the safety and security of the country’s food supply, especially in the rice sub-sector, to always be sufficient and sustainable,” Mohamad Sabu said in a statement.
